Creation of the Universe
Quranic Description
- "Joined entity" (ratq): The heavens and earth were once unified
- "Separated them" (fataq): They were then split apart
- "From water every living thing": Water as the basis of all life
Modern Science Confirms
- Big Bang Theory: Universe began from a single point
- Cosmic Expansion: Continuous expansion since initial event
- Water and Life: H2O essential for all biological processes
Modern cosmology confirms that the universe began from a single point and has been expanding since the "Big Bang." The Quran described this process over 1,400 years ago. Furthermore, every living thing's dependence on water is a fundamental scientific principle that the Quran highlighted.

The Water Cycle
The Quran beautifully describes the water cycle in multiple verses, demonstrating understanding of a process that wasn't fully comprehended until modern meteorology:
Quranic References
- "We sent down water from heaven": Precipitation from clouds
- "Springs from the earth": Groundwater and natural springs
- "Rivers flowing": Surface water movement
- "We made from water every living thing": Water's role in life
Scientific Process
- Evaporation: Solar energy converts water to vapor
- Condensation: Vapor forms clouds in atmosphere
- Precipitation: Water returns to earth as rain/snow
- Collection: Water gathers in rivers, lakes, oceans
These verses reference the continuous circulation of water - from evaporation to precipitation to sustaining all life - a process that wasn't fully understood until modern meteorology developed sophisticated understanding of atmospheric dynamics.

The Expanding Universe
Quranic Indication
- "We are [its] expander" (la-musi'un): Continuous expansion
- "With strength" (bi-aydin): Powerful forces involved
- Present tense: Ongoing process, not completed event
Modern Astronomy
- Hubble's Law: Galaxies moving away from each other
- Redshift Observations: Light wavelengths stretched by expansion
- Dark Energy: Mysterious force accelerating expansion
Modern astronomy has confirmed that the universe is expanding, with galaxies moving away from each other - exactly as the Quran suggests through verses about the heavens being stretched out. This discovery, made in the 20th century, was indicated in the Quran over 1400 years ago.
Respectful Science
Islam encourages the pursuit of knowledge and understanding of Allah's creation. The Quran repeatedly calls upon believers to observe, think, and reflect on the signs of Allah in nature. This scientific mindset has historically led to major advances in mathematics, medicine, astronomy, and other fields by Muslim scholars.
